Warning Signs You Need Bathroom Water Damage Restoration

Catching water damage early can save you money and prevent bigger problems down the line. Here are some common warning signs that you may need bathroom water damage restoration: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Musty odors are a common sign of water damage in bathrooms.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your bathroom, it’s likely due to hidden water damage or mold growth.

Water Spots or Stains on the Ceiling or Walls

Water spots or stains on the ceiling or walls can be a sign of water damage or leaks in your bathroom. If you notice any water spots or stains, it’s essential to investigate further to find out the cause.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age or excessive moisture in your bathroom. If you notice any warping or buckling,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Leaks Under the Sink or Around the Toilet

Leaks under the sink or around the toilet can be a sign of a larger issue with your bathroom’s plumbing or fixtures. If you notice any leaks,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Visible Water Damage or Leaks

Visible water damage or leaks in your bathroom can be a sign of a major issue that needs immediate attention. If you notice any water damage or leaks, don’t hesitate to call us for help.

Discoloration or Staining on Fixtures or Surfaces

Discoloration or staining on fixtures or surfaces can be a sign of water damage or mineral buildup. If you notice any discoloration or staining,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Bathroom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ak under the sink Yes No You can likely fix the leak yourself with a wrench and some pliers.
Major flood in the bathroom No Yes A major flood needs professional equipment and expertise to safely and effectively restore your bathroom.
Warped or buckled flooring Maybe Yes Warped or buckled flooring may need professional repair or replacement, especially if it’s due to water damage.
Visible water damage or leaks No Yes Visible water damage or leaks need immediate attention and professional expertise to prevent further damage.
Discoloration or staining on fixtures or surfaces Maybe Yes Discoloration or staining may need professional cleaning or restoration, especially if it’s due to water damage or mineral buildup.

Bathroom Water Damage Restoration Cost in Pen Argyl, PA

The cost of bathroom water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ions in Pen Argyl, PA. Our estimates range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the scope of the work.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ment used
Drying and Dehumidification $300 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ment used
Repair or Replacement of Damaged Materials $1,000 – $3,000 Type and extent of damage, complexity of repair
Insurance Claims Help $100 – $500 Complexity of claims process, number of interactions with insurance company
